    <description>ITAT upheld CIT(A)&#039;s deletion of an addition under s.69 after the assessee satisfactorily proved one source and produced banked loan receipts from her brother and his HUF for the balance. The AO and CIT(A) recorded no adverse findings on lenders&#039; identity, creditworthiness or genuineness. Given the assessee&#039;s long-term NRI status and documentary proof, the tribunal found no basis for addition and allowed the appeal.</description>
